- Name Meaning
- "Nada" Means "dew" or "generous" in Arabic, and is also a pet form of the Russian name Nadezhda, "hope".

Origin and History of the name Nada
This name derives from the Old Church Slavonic “Nadéžda (Надежда)”, meaning “hope”, a translation of the Ancient Greek word “elpís (ἐλπίς)”, with the same meaning.
The name began to be used in Western Europe around the 19th-century.It suddenly became much more common due to the popularity of Romanian gymnast Nadia Comăneci, spreading to all Western countries.
It should be noted that the name is almost a homograph to Nadiyya, Nadya, Nadia, an Arabic name, which means “tender, delicate”.
